Transaction 23cf3c185b337c7137ababd0451ad5303d727d0845edb91b1e9aaec81a608e69
1 Input
1 Output
-
23cf3c185b337c7137ababd0451ad5303d727d0845edb91b1e9aaec81a608e69:0
- value
- 378056
- script pubkey
- OP_0 OP_PUSHBYTES_20 245a785fad08168d4c3c805be1a912070de20ca9
- address
- bc1qy3d8shadpqtg6npuspd7r2gjqux7yr9ft2scya